T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model belongs to the field of maglev rail transit, more particularly to a kind of turnout plate mechanism for medium-low speed maglev transit system. BACKGROUND
[0002] Compared with other urban rail transit with same transport capacity, medium-low speed maglev system has strong competitiveness in terms of technical advancement, passenger comfort, safety, economy, energy saving and environmental protection, etc. With the breakthroughs in vehicle suspension control, track, turnout, signal and other core technologies in recent years, medium-low speed maglev research and development achievements have reached the conditions for commercial operation.
[0003] Maglev turnout is an important part of medium-low speed maglev transit system, which undertakes the task of line change of maglev vehicles, and its quality determines the safety, reliability and comfort of embedded maglev transit system. As an important component of turnout system for bearing and transferring force, the quality and precision of turnout plate directly affect the driving safety when maglev train passes. SUMMARY

[0033] Reference Figures 1 to 5As shown, the figure shows a turnout plate mechanism for a low-speed maglev transportation system.
[0034] Preferably, the turnout plate mechanism comprises at least a turnout prefabricated plate 100 and a guide rail 102 arranged on the turnout prefabricated plate 100, and a turnout unit 200 to be moved is arranged on the guide rail 102 through a guide support 300. The turnout unit 200 can move along the guide rail 102 under the action of the guide support 300. Thus, the accurate movement adjustment problem of the turnout unit 200 is solved through the design of the guide rail 102 structure on the turnout plate mechanism.
[0035] In addition, the turnout prefabricated plate 100 is prefabricated in the factory, installed on site, improves the efficiency of on-site construction, reduces the influence of construction on the surrounding environment and construction cost. The turnout prefabricated plate 100 is a reinforced concrete structure, adopts modular design, can be applied to various types of turnout structures, is convenient for construction and installation, and can be applied to bridges, tunnels and roadbeds.
[0036] Preferably, the turnout plate mechanism further comprises a plurality of guide rail mounting bosses 101. The guide rail mounting bosses 101 are fixed on the turnout prefabricated plate 100, and the guide rail 102 is fixedly arranged on the guide rail mounting bosses 101.
[0037] Further, the guide rail mounting bosses 101 are provided with guide rail mounting holes 106, and the guide rail 102 is fixedly connected with the guide rail mounting bosses 101 through screws assembled in the guide rail mounting holes 106. Further, the guide rail mounting holes 106 are high-precision mounting holes machined to ensure the installation precision of the guide rail 102.
[0038] Preferably, the turnout plate mechanism further comprises a plurality of corner bosses 103 for realizing corner positioning. The corner bosses 103 are arranged at the edges of the turnout prefabricated plate 100. During construction, the relative distance between each corner boss 103 and the surveying network can be measured to realize the positioning of the position offset of each turnout prefabricated plate 100. Thus, the construction personnel can adjust the position based on the position offset of each turnout prefabricated plate 100 to realize the purpose of adjusting and controlling the position precision between the plates.
[0039] Preferably, a plurality of first embedded sleeves 104 are embedded on the surface of the turnout prefabricated plate 100. The first embedded sleeves 104 are used to prevent the deformation of the turnout plate by adjusting the height thereof (for eliminating the deflection caused by self-weight) to ensure the vertical position precision of the guide rail.
[0040] Preferably, a plurality of second embedded sleeves 105 are embedded in the side wall of the turnout prefabricated slab 100. The second embedded sleeves 105 are used to realize hoisting and fine adjustment of longitudinal and transverse positions, so as to facilitate transportation, hoisting and adjustment of the position of the turnout slab.
[0041] Preferably, the guide support 300 comprises at least a bracket 301, a sliding support plate 302 and a guide wheel 303. The sliding support plate 302 and the guide wheel 303 are arranged at the bottom of the bracket 301. The guide wheel 303 is rotationally connected to the bracket 301 through a guide wheel shaft 304.
[0042] The sliding support plate 302 is in contact with the upper surface of the guide rail 102, and the rotation surface of the guide wheel 303 is in contact with the side surface of the guide rail 102.
[0043] Preferably, the bracket 301 is bolted to the bottom of the turnout unit 200.
[0044] Further, the sliding support plate 302 is made of self-lubricating wear-resistant material. The sliding support plate 302 is made of self-lubricating wear-resistant material, which reduces the later maintenance work.
